Front Royal, VA Apartments for Rent

Nestled at the confluence of the North and South Forks of the Shenandoah River, Front Royal combines historic charm and natural surroundings. Known as the "Canoe Capital of Virginia," Front Royal serves as a gateway to the Blue Ridge Mountains and Shenandoah National Park, providing access to outdoor recreation while being 76 miles from Washington D.C. The town's history dates back to 1754, with a historic district featuring 19th-century architecture that adds character to this community of approximately 15,400 residents.

Apartments for rent in Front Royal offer housing options at lower price points than those in nearby metropolitan areas, with one-bedroom units averaging around $771 per month. The town features everyday conveniences, local restaurants, and historical attractions including the Warren Heritage Society. Front Royal's location at the intersection of US Routes 340 and 522, with Interstate 66 passing just north, provides access to employment centers in Northern Virginia. The presence of Christendom College and the Smithsonian Conservation Biology Institute contributes to the town's educational resources.
